Five Hundred Years After

Steven Brust

Original title: Five hundred years after

first published 1994 New York : TOR,, 1994 paperback 443 pages

The story takes place 500 years after the events portrayed in the author's previous novel, The Phoenix Guard. Four Empire loyalists, Khaavren, Perl, Aerich and Tazendra, battle a plot to destroy the Orb of the Empire and overthrow the Emperor.
